One Wallet, No Hidden Costs

The single wallet is the first thing you notice. You don’t move money between a casino balance and a sportsbook balance. Every deposit lands in the same pot, and every withdrawal comes from it. Deposits start at £10 and clear instantly. No fees on either side – which already puts Neptune ahead of operators that charge 2-3% for certain methods. E-wallet withdrawals via PayPal or Trustly can land within 60 minutes after your first KYC check. Bank transfers take up to 9 days, but the fastest route is the one most people use anyway.

Game Selection – Slots, Tables, and Live Dealers

The library runs on the Aspire Global platform and pulls from 38 providers including Pragmatic Play, NetEnt, Evolution Gaming, and Play’n GO. That’s over 2,400 titles. New slots land about 10 per week, so the catalogue stays current without feeling bloated. You can search by provider – typing “Pragmatic Play” gives you 412 results. The RTP for every slot is visible before you spin, which matters if you track house edge across sessions.

Slot variety breaks down like this:

  • Classic slots: Starburst, Fire Joker – low volatility, three-reel simplicity.
  • Video slots: Book of Dead, Big Bass Bonanza – free spins, multipliers, bonus buys.
  • Megaways: Beware the Deep Megaways – up to 117,649 ways to win.
  • Progressive jackpots: pooled prize games that grow network-wide.
  • Drops & Wins: Pragmatic Play tournaments with daily random cash prizes.

Table games sit in a separate section – virtual blackjack, roulette, baccarat, poker, plus Sic Bo and Craps. Stakes start at £1. The live dealer lobby streams from Evolution and Playtech, with over 70 blackjack variants and game shows like Crazy Time and Funky Time. Minimum on live blackjack tables is £1; high-roller seats go up to £5,000 per hand.

Sports Betting and the Welcome Offer

The sportsbook shares your casino wallet and covers football, horse racing, tennis, basketball, esports, darts, and boxing. In-play markets update in real time, and you can cash out selected bets. Betting margins average around 8.18% – fine for a combined casino-sports account, but not as tight as a dedicated sportsbook.

New players get a 100% deposit match up to £200 plus 25 free spins on Book of Dead. The spins pay out as real cash – no wagering. The bonus funds require 40x wagering within 72 hours, and only slots count toward that. The welcome offer is straightforward, but the short expiry means you need to play actively from the start. Here’s the quick process:

  1. Deposit £10 or more using any method (no promo code needed).
  2. The 25 free spins land automatically – use them on Book of Dead.
  3. Bonus funds appear as match credit – clear the 40x wagering on slots within 72 hours.
  4. Winnings from free spins are withdrawable immediately; bonus winnings need wagering met first.

There’s also a separate sports welcome: place £10 at odds of 2.00+ to get a £10 free bet plus 10 spins on Book of Dead, no wagering on free bet returns.

Deposit, Withdrawal, and Licensing

Neptune holds UKGC licence № 39483, issued to AG Communications Limited. That means segregated player funds, SSL 128-bit encryption, and full responsible gambling tools – deposit limits, time reminders, self-exclusion. KYC verification is required before the first withdrawal; most cases clear within 24-48 hours.

16 payment methods are available, all in GBP, no crypto. The table below shows the most common options and their typical withdrawal speeds:

Payment Method Min Deposit Deposit Fee Withdrawal Speed (after KYC)
PayPal £10 None 0-2 business days (often within 60 mins)
Trustly £10 None 0-2 business days
Debit Card (Visa/Mastercard) £10 None 1-4 business days
Bank Transfer £10 None 3-9 business days
Paysafecard £10 None Deposits only

It’s worth noting that Paysafecard can’t be used for withdrawals, and the minimum withdrawal across all methods is £10. If your balance dips below that, you can still request the full amount.
